50 Shia martyred in twin explosions in main Parachinar
Twin explosions in the Shia populated Kurram tribal region’s main Parachinar bazaar has martyred more than 50 people and injured more than 100 Shia Muslims on Friday. Three of the injured are said to be in critical condition.
The first blast occurred in the Main Parachinar Bazaar in Kurram Agency and was planted on a motorbike. The second blast occurred on the main School road, confirmed political adminsistration officials.
Security forces reached the site of blast and cordoned off the area as a probe into the incident went underway.
Lower Kurram tribal region is also one of the sensitive FATA agency, which borders with three of Afghanistan’s provinces and at one point of time was one of the key route for militant movement across the border.
The region was cleared of militants during a military operation a couple of years ago however militants still carry out sectarian attacks and also target security forces occasionally.
Shiite Organizations Majlis e Wehdatul Muslimeen, Shia Ulema Council, Tehreek-e-Hussaini and others condemned the attack and announced three days mourning to mourn the incident.
